Я написал модель / представление / коллекцию, используя Backbone.js. Моя коллекция использует метод выборки для загрузки моделей с удаленного сервера. URL-адрес, необходимый для этой коллекции, должен иметь идентификатор, например: messages / {id}. Но я не нашел чистого способа передать параметры Коллекции.
Представление backbone.js принимает параметры, передавая их при построении: view ([options]), но коллекция ожидает список моделей при построении: collection ([models]).
Каков самый «чистый» способ передачи параметров / параметров в эту коллекцию?
Сокращенный код:
var Messages = Backbone.Collection.extend({
model: Message,
url: 'http://url/messages/' + id
});